₱8,000,000.00 Worth of Alleged Smuggled Cigarettes Seized in Divisoria

PNP personnel of Zamboanga City Police Station 5 together with the Tasked Force Zamboanga (TFZ) assigned at the fixed checkpoint located at Barangay Divisoria, Zamboanga City at 2:15 AM of July 27, 2021 flagged down one (1) eight wheeler truck FUSO with plate number CAY 8647 containing boxes of alleged smuggled cigarettes and empty blue plastic drums driven by Jereel Hofelina y Morales, 41years old, male, separated and a resident of Barangay Talisayan, Zamboanga City together with his truckman Alnasher Arraji y Sakkam, 36 years old, male, married and a resident of Barangay San Roque, Zamboanga City. Said driver and his truckman were asked by personnel  of Zamboanga City Police Station 5 for pertinent documents but failed to show any to support their claims. Upon inventory, said alleged smuggled cigarettes and empty drums were as follows: 30 Empty Blue Plastic Drums, 190 Boxes New Berlin Cigarettes, 225 Boxes Fort Cigarettes, 24 Boxes Cannon cigarettes with a total of 439 boxes and with estimated market value amounting to more or less ₱ 8,000,000.00. Further, said Eight Wheeler Truck FUSO. Suspects and confiscated items are presently under the custody of Zamboanga City Police Station 5 for proper disposition.

Shooting Incident

A shooting incident transpired at Purok Bayabas, Barangay Ali Alsree, RT Lim, Zamboanga Sibugay at 10:50 PM of July 26, 2021. Victims were identified as Dennis Ricaborda Coraza, 35 years old, single, businessman and a resident of Purok Bayabas, Barangay Ali Alsree, RT Lim, Zamboanga Sibugay and Patricia Ricaborda Coraza, 66 years old, married, jobless and a resident of the same place. They were allegedly shot by unidentified suspect/s. Investigation disclosed that prior to the incident, while the victims were sleeping in their house, unidentified suspect/s smashed the wall of their house and shot the victims using an unidentified caliber of pistol. After which, the suspect fled the scene towards unknown direction, victims incurred gunshot wounds in their stomach and were rushed to Zamboanga Sibugay Provincial Hospital. PNP personnel of RT Lim Municipal Police Station are now conducting follow-up operation for the arrest of the suspect.

Shooting Incident

A shooting incident transpired along the highway of Barangay Recodo, Zamboanga City at 5:40 PM of July 26, 2021 near the boundary of Barangay Ayala. Victim was identified as Zosimo Batoy y Espinosa, male, married, 55 years old, Manager of Universal Fishing and a resident Dacon Homes, Barangay Recodo, Zamboanga City he was shot by unidentified suspect/s. Investigation disclosed that at 5:40 PM of same date, victim was on board his Nissan Navarra which was parked alongside of the road in front of his store when unidentified suspect/s appeared and without apparent reason, shot the victim trice hitting the different parts of his body. After the incident, suspect/s fled towards west coast on board a motorcycle while victim was rushed to Brent hospital for medical treatment but was declared dead on arrival by the attending Physician. During ocular inspection, recovered on the crime scene were three (3) empty fired cartridges of Caliber 45.

Farmer Arrested in Drug Buy-Bust Operation in Aurora

PNP personnel of Aurora Municipal Police Station conducted drug buy- bust operation at Purok La Joma, Barangay San Jose, Aurora, Zamboanga del Sur at 10:45 AM of July 26, 2021. The operation resulted in the arrest of Ariel Priolo y Arnigo aka “Timot”, 18 years old, single, farmer and a resident of Barangay Anonang, Aurora, Zamboanga del Sur. Confiscated during the operation were one piece small size heat sealed transparent sachet containing white crystalline substance believed to be Shabu (fruit of buy-bust), one piece rectangular type heat sealed transparent sachet containing white crystalline substance believed to be Shabu (possession), and one piece of five hundred pesos (₱ 500.00) as marked money. Confiscated substance believed to be Shabu has estimated weight of .05 grams and has standard drug price of three hundred forty pesos (₱ 340. 00). He is now under the custody of Aurora Municipal Police Station for documentation and proper disposition.

Man Arrested in Drug Buy-Bust Operation in Kasanyangan

Station Drug Enforcement Team of Zamboanga City Police Station 5 conducted buy-bust operation on illegal drugs at Phase 1 Asinan, Barangay Kasanyangan, Zamboanga City at 1:30 PM of July 26, 2021. The operation resulted in the arrest of Imran Sulayman y Tawasil a.k.a “Labo”, 19 years old, male, single, jobless, highschool level, of Barangay Kasanyangan, Zamboanga City. Confiscated from his possession were Six (6) sachets of suspected Shabu with a standard drug price of P13,600.00 weighing 2 grams and three (3) bills of P100.00 as marked money. He is now under the custody of Zamboanga City Police Station 5 in preparation for filing of appropriate charges in court. All recovered items will be brought to Zamboanga City Crime Laboratory Office for examination.

Man Arrested in Drug Buy-Bust Operation in Kasanyangan

PNP personnel of Zamboanga City Drug Enforcement Unit together with Zamboanga City Police Station 11 conducted anti-illegal drugs operation at Barangay Kasanyangan, Zamboanga City at about 9:00 PM of July 26, 2021. The operation resulted in the arrest of Sulaiman Goena y Jahuran a.k.a. “Sulaiman”, 42 years old, male, married, jobless, no educational attainment, and a resident of Phase 1, Barangay Kasanyangan, Zamboanga City. Recovered during the operation were six (6) sachets of suspected Shabu with a standard drug price of ₱ 6, 800.00 pesos weighing 1 gram, one (1) coin purse and one (1) bill of ₱ 200.00 as marked money. He is now under the custody of Zamboanga City Police Station 11 in preparation of filing of appropriate charges in court. All recovered sachets of suspected shabu will be brought to Zamboanga City Crime Laboratory Office for examination.
